Halloween Squares received

I received my lovely Halloween squares from Pam on Tuesday. She used lambswool linen and Belle Soie and HDF silks (one day I'll have silks) and took parts from different designs to create this one. I don't know if you can see, but the pumpkins, bats and owl are stitched over one, they are so cute IRL!


 
 
Thank you so much for a lovely exchange Pam, it's beautiful!
